Job Description / Minimum Requirements:

The Worker will serve as a senior Business Analyst/Product Owner for the modernization projects. The Worker will be responsible for delivering quality products that meet the state's desired operational and technical requirements. The worker will have considerable latitude to use their experience and judgement to ensure successful completion of their assigned tasks. The Worker will be required to multi-task, analyze priorities, communicate clearly, and set expectations for the phases of the project. The worker will be responsible for communicating with multiple internal and external stakeholders including program and technical staff, and other contracted and vendor resources. The Worker will participate in meetings, track deliverables and schedules, and alert management of any issues that may impact providers.
The services to be provided include, but are not limited to the following:
A. Analyzes program policies, procedures, and processes to determine the impact on business systems and functional areas.
B. Analyzes and reviews system, data, and project deliverables such as business user requirements, design documentation, test plans, and risk assessment plans to ensure business and technical requirements are met.
C. Works with program area staff to solicit, analyze and document business processes and requirements.
D. Acts as a liaison between state staff and vendors to translate operational and business requirements to vendors.
E. Serves as the Product Owner for an agile team, including working with agile/scrum teams of contracted software vendors to implement system changes.
F. Analyzes and writes User Stories with Acceptance Criteria based on business needs and according to the Agile methodology.
G. Develops and maintains business user test scenarios and participates in systems and user acceptance testing.
H. Creates use case scenarios, test plans, and exit criteria that accurately map back to the documented business requirements or user stories.
I. Reviews, analyzes and executes test cases with a formal testing tool.
J. Tracks, documents and reports the status of testing.
K. Evaluates proposed test strategies to ensure appropriate test coverage.
L. Identifies potential project risks and issues and develops mitigation strategies,
M. Reports project status to management on established timelines.
N. Documents action items and business decisions.
O. Conducts meetings and/or presentation tasks as needed.
P. Manages schedule for deliverables as established.
Q. Other duties as assigned related to the project.
